About the Role: Care Manager RN
We're seeking an experienced Care Manager RN to join our team in Oklahoma as a full-time field-based telecommuter. As a Care Manager RN, you'll be responsible for driving and supporting care management and care coordination activities across the continuum of care. This is an exciting opportunity to make a meaningful impact on the lives of our members and contribute to the success of our organization.
Key Responsibilities:
- Conduct telephonic and/or in-person assessments, planning, execution, and coordination of all care management activities with members to evaluate their clinical and behavioral health needs.
- Develop proactive plans to address issues and opportunities to enhance member outcomes and overall well-being.
- Utilize clinical devices and data/information review to conduct comprehensive assessments and determine the approach to case resolution.
- Apply clinical judgment to integrate strategies aimed at reducing risk factors and addressing complex health and social determinants that impact care planning.
- Perform crisis intervention with members experiencing a social health or clinical crisis and refer them to appropriate clinical providers.
- Provide crisis follow-up to ensure members receive suitable treatment/services.
- Collaborate with interdisciplinary care teams to achieve optimal outcomes.
- Identify and escalate quality of care issues through established channels.
- Utilize influencing/motivational interviewing skills to ensure maximum member engagement and recognize their health status and needs.
- Provide education, information, and support to empower members to make informed clinical and lifestyle decisions.
Essential Qualifications:
- Current unencumbered Oklahoma state licensure as an RN.
- 3+ years of clinical practice experience (e.g., hospital setting or alternative care setting).
- Completion of Social Health Caseworker certification training provided through the Department of Mental Health and Substance Abuse Services within six months of hire date.
- 2+ years of experience using PC, keyboard navigation, navigating multiple systems and applications, and utilizing MS Office Suite applications.
- Ability to travel in-state up to 30% of the time, with mileage reimbursement per company policy.
- Willingness to provide on-call CM coverage for evenings and weekends on a rotational schedule as required by the State regulatory agency.
Preferred Qualifications:
- Experience caring for Native American/American Indian/Alaskan Native populations.
- Case management in an integrated model preferred.
- Managed care/utilization review experience preferred.
- Discharge planning experience preferred.
- BSN degree preferred.
